It also requires that the `discover_dns_record` lookup table be populated by the included support search \"Discover DNS record\".

Splunk>Phantom Playbook Integration

If Splunk>Phantom is also configured in your environment, a Playbook called \"DNS Hijack Investigation\" can be configured to run when any results are found by this detection search. The playbook takes in the DNS record changed and uses Geoip, whois, Censys and PassiveTotal to detect if DNS issuers changed. To use this integration, install the Phantom App for Splunk https://splunkbase.splunk.com/app/3411/, add the correct hostname to the \"Phantom Instance\" field in the Adaptive Response Actions when configuring this detection search, and set the corresponding Playbook to active.
(Playbook Link:https://my.phantom.us/4.1/playbook/dns-hijack-investigation/).
